Output 29a588504b704753958365101b0bb8df896c53c4542ad8bbaaf4978bf16b2cf2:1

value
102709496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e0d6b2488a60676c3fb1644d0e92a948c655cee OP_EQUAL
address
3G6imBtPUtr3BqRxA7urmxeuN1tPHEJj9M
transaction
29a588504b704753958365101b0bb8df896c53c4542ad8bbaaf4978bf16b2cf2
confirmations
378568
spent
true